The defining characteristic of these foams is a very high porosity with typically 75.
A metallic foam or ceramic foam is a cellular structure consisting of a solid metal or ceramic material containing a large volume fraction of gas filled pores.

Ceramic foam is a tough foam made from ceramics manufacturing techniques include impregnating open cell polymer foams internally with ceramic slurry and then firing in a kiln leaving only ceramic material the foams may consist of several ceramic materials such as aluminium oxide a common high temperature ceramic and gets insulating properties from the many tiny air filled voids within the.
The pores can be sealed closed cell foam or can form an interconnected network open cell foam.
